**Migration step 4 — retry failed exports.** After cutover to Lundqvist v2, re-run any exports stuck in FAILED. Use the bulk-retry endpoint, batch size 50, backoff enabled. Don't retry exports older than 14 days; archive those instead. Verify counts against the Torsby ledger before closing the ticket. The retry worker reads the following settings at startup.

config for bahop-fajep:
DRUATH_PIN=4501
DRUATH_TENANT=briwyn
DRUATH_METRICS_HOST=metrics.druath.brasksoft.test
DRUATH_SEAL=seal_7d2e069d
DRUATH_STANDBY_TEAM=olieth

### Runbook: Crumbwell Order-Cutoff Rule

For the weekly sync: the Crumbwell bakery platform enforces an order cutoff so production sheets can be generated before the overnight bake. Orders arriving after cutoff roll to the next bake day automatically; there is no manual override in the storefront. If stores report orders landing on the wrong day, check the cutoff evaluation first before blaming the scheduler. The cutoff service currently runs with the following configuration.

service settings:
novath:
  pin: 1396
  tenant: pelys
  seal: seal_ccc035e1
  metrics_host: metrics.novath.qorvelworks.test
  standby_team: fraeth
  escalation: drueth-zorok
  nonce: 61d508

## Authentication

The nightly search reindex job on Quillbarrow runs under the `reindex-batch` service identity, not a user session. It authenticates to the Lanternfell index gateway over mutual TLS, then presents a scoped key limited to read-replica access and index-write operations on the `catalog_v3` namespace. Rotation occurs every 30 days via the Vaultwren scheduler; old keys are revoked within one hour. For audit purposes, the currently active key is recorded below.

gateway credential: kto3_qfe

Step 4: Webhook retry semantics. Grindle 3.x replaces fixed-interval retries with exponential backoff plus jitter, capped at six attempts per delivery. Dead-lettered payloads now persist for 14 days instead of being dropped. Make sure downstream consumers are idempotent before enabling the new scheduler, since duplicate deliveries are possible during the overlap window. The settings governing retry behavior in the new release are listed below.

settings of tagef-bawif:
DRUIX_HOST=druix.zemvarlabs.internal
DRUIX_PORT=8000